Charity overview

Activities - how the charity spends its money

To promote the benefits of the inhabitants of Poole Old Town. To provide facilities in the interests of social welfare for the recreation and leisure time occupation with the object of improving the condition of life for the said inhabitants. To provide social and well being activities for the inhabitants of the area of benefit.
